It’s quite different from the US tho.

In China’s finance industry, it’s almost impossible for undergraduates to get a full-time role directly, most positions require at least a Master’s degree. Intern-to-ft conversion is very rare at the undergrad level, and some sell-side firms don’t even provide official internship certificates to undergrad interns.
